More than 100 people are reported to have joined the search effort and local train services are running at reduced speed Police are urging people to check their gardens and sheds for a three-year-old boy who went missing on Tuesday during a visit to a playground near the Suffolk-Essex border. The boy, named Noah, was last seen at 3pm in Merriam Close in Brantham, near Manningtree, before being separated from a relative. Officers from Suffolk constabulary said that Noah was reported to have run down an alleyway near the playground towards a housing estate. Continue reading...
